The Residence Inn penthouse suite was my Dad and my home base during a recent Southern California visit. I chose this hotel among the many, many "suite" hotel options as it was the only one with two separate sleeping areas AND two bathrooms. These were key when traveling with my 85 year old father! For this I paid a bit more (around$110/night AAA rate), but that was still far cheaper than renting two regular hotel rooms and the other places "suites" were usually just a sleeper sofa the other side of a half wall.
The main selling point of this hotel is room size and amenities. Full kitchen, full refrigerator, all dishes and pans, 3 flat screen tvs, 2 full bathrooms, 2 bedrooms (very comfy king, queen beds), lots of square footage. Note: The penthouse suites are located on the second floor with no elevator access.
There is a continental breakfast included, nothing special, but adequate. (why is the fruit on these spreads always green?). They also do a managers social hour, on Monday the week we were there. It featured really cheap wine, beer that tasted like water, popcorn and potato chips, BBQ beef sandwiches, and salad. Other guests seemed to be making a dinner of it.
All in all for a family or multiple adults who want to have lots of room and separate sleeping/bathroom areas, this is a great option!
